What It Is:
This is an addition worksheet featuring 'Mitch the Mailman.' It contains twelve addition problems with two-digit numbers. It also includes a word problem where students must add 50 and 38 to find the total number of delivered items.
Grade Level Suitability:
This worksheet is suitable for 2nd grade students. The addition problems involve adding two 2-digit numbers, which is a common skill taught at this grade level. The word problem is also age-appropriate.
Why Use It:
This worksheet provides practice in addition skills, specifically adding two-digit numbers. It also reinforces problem-solving skills through the word problem. The mailman theme adds a fun and engaging element to the practice.
How to Use It:
Students should solve each of the twelve addition problems by adding the two numbers together and writing the answer below the line. Then, they should read the word problem and add 50 and 38 to find the total number of items Mitch delivered.
Target Users:
This worksheet is targeted towards 2nd grade students who are learning and practicing addition skills. It is also suitable for students who need extra practice with two-digit addition and simple word problems.
